NBNA Conference 2008 The National Black Nurses Association will
hold it's 36th
Annual Institute and Conference in Las Vegas, NV, August
4-8, 2008 at the
The Mandalay Bay Resort & Casino. Las Vegas, NV
will welcome over 1,000 NBNA attendees, including
nurses, student nurses, health professionals and health
industries and over 120
exhibiting companies. Our theme this year is
"Nursing Practice: The Prevention and Management of
Chronic Diseases". A wide variety of sessions are
scheduled for the four-day conference, offering our
members and attendees continuing education credits and a
variety of learning venues.
